summaryrefslogtreecommitdiffstats
path: root/logic/net
diff options
context:
space:
mode:
authorPetr Mrázek <peterix@gmail.com>2013-10-11 16:13:01 +0200
committerPetr Mrázek <peterix@gmail.com>2013-10-11 16:13:01 +0200
commitf8b4c2c0b25f89017db2702b60d47df7376b32e6 (patch)
tree0415568ad3081da755027091ba254f157606f06d /logic/net
parenta9ceea27cccc7c59be2e5b19e29431e6c0a6b335 (diff)
downloadMultiMC-f8b4c2c0b25f89017db2702b60d47df7376b32e6.tar
MultiMC-f8b4c2c0b25f89017db2702b60d47df7376b32e6.tar.gz
MultiMC-f8b4c2c0b25f89017db2702b60d47df7376b32e6.tar.lz
MultiMC-f8b4c2c0b25f89017db2702b60d47df7376b32e6.tar.xz
MultiMC-f8b4c2c0b25f89017db2702b60d47df7376b32e6.zip
Fix auth for 13w41a
Diffstat (limited to 'logic/net')
-rw-r--r--logic/net/LoginTask.cpp2
-rw-r--r--logic/net/LoginTask.h3
2 files changed, 3 insertions, 2 deletions
diff --git a/logic/net/LoginTask.cpp b/logic/net/LoginTask.cpp
index 5de8efa9..90aac74a 100644
--- a/logic/net/LoginTask.cpp
+++ b/logic/net/LoginTask.cpp
@@ -264,6 +264,6 @@ void LoginTask::parseYggdrasilReply(QByteArray data)
};
*/
- result = {uInfo.username, sessionID, playerName, playerID};
+ result = {uInfo.username, sessionID, playerName, playerID, accessToken};
emitSucceeded();
}
diff --git a/logic/net/LoginTask.h b/logic/net/LoginTask.h
index ba87142d..daea18af 100644
--- a/logic/net/LoginTask.h
+++ b/logic/net/LoginTask.h
@@ -27,9 +27,10 @@ struct UserInfo
struct LoginResponse
{
QString username;
- QString session_id;
+ QString session_id; // session id is a combination of player id and the access token
QString player_name;
QString player_id;
+ QString access_token;
};
class QNetworkReply;